* alias.c (record_alias_subset): Remove ignored `&'.
(init_alias_once): Likewise.
* c-lex.c (UNGETC): Cast first argument of comma expression to void.
* config/mips/mips.c (mips_asm_file_end): Cast the result of
fwrite to `int' when comparing against one.
* config/mips/mips.h (CAN_ELIMINATE): Add parens around && within ||.
(INITIAL_ELIMINATION_OFFSET): Add braces to avoid ambiguous `else'.
* cse.c (rehash_using_reg): Change type of variable `i' to
unsigned int.
* dwarf2out.c (initial_return_save): Cast -1 to unsigned before
assigning it to one.
* except.c (duplicate_eh_handlers): Remove unused variable `tmp'.
* final.c (final_scan_insn): Likewise for variable `i'.
(output_asm_insn): Cast a char to unsigned char when used as an
array index.
* gcse.c (compute_pre_ppinout): Cast -1 to SBITMAP_ELT_TYPE when
assigning it to one.
* loop.c (strength_reduce): Remove unused variables `count' and `temp'.
* recog.c (preprocess_constraints): Cast a char to unsigned char
when used as an array index.
* regmove.c (find_matches): Likewise.
* reload1.c (calculate_needs): Add default case in switch.
(eliminate_regs_in_insn): Initialize variable `offset'.
(set_offsets_for_label): Change type of variable `i' to unsigned.
(reload_as_needed): Wrap variable `i' in macro check on
AUTO_INC_DEC || INSN_CLOBBERS_REGNO_P.
* scan-decls.c (scan_decls): Mark parameters `argc' and `argv'
with ATTRIBUTE_UNUSED. Cast variable `start_written' to size_t
when comparing against one.
* stor-layout.c (layout_decl): Cast maximum_field_alignment to
unsigned when comparing against one. Likewise for
GET_MODE_ALIGNMENT().
(layout_record): Cast record_align to int when comparing against a
signed value.
(layout_type): Cast TYPE_ALIGN() to int when comparing against a
signed value.
* tree.c (get_identifier): Cast variable `len' to unsigned when
comparing against one.
(maybe_get_identifier): Likewise
